About the file formats "PDF, NC1, DXF,DWG, ZIP". This requires further analysis.
I expect that Microsoft Search will only index the filenames for the nc1, dxf and dwg files. The contents will not be searchable. Can you test this?
The files within the zip files should be indexed (if the zip file does not use encryption). However, the indexer cannot index certain file formats such as dwg.
PDF: these files should be indexed. Do the pdf files use encryption or only contain an image? The latter may happen when a document is scanned to pdf format and there is no OCR step involved.
I would test the configuration of the libraries itself by adding a simple Office file. The indexing should not take more than a few minutes.
